Local Weather Risks in Antioch

🌪️

Triggers

Heavy rainfall can overwhelm compromised roofing systems, while high winds can lift shingles, tiles, or membrane roofing. Hail storms can create punctures and cracks in various roofing materials. Extended heat waves can cause thermal expansion and contraction that weakens seals and fasteners. Sudden temperature drops following rain can lead to ice formation in vulnerable areas.

📅

Seasonal Risks

Antioch experiences seasonal weather patterns that can stress roofing systems. Winter rains from November through March often reveal existing weaknesses, while summer heat can accelerate material deterioration. Spring and fall wind events can test roof fastening systems. Older neighborhoods with aging roofs may be particularly vulnerable during seasonal transitions when temperature fluctuations stress materials.

🏚️

Disaster Scenarios

Post-storm scenarios often reveal hidden damage that wasn't apparent during calm weather. Wind-driven rain can force water under compromised flashing or through damaged areas. After significant weather events, it's common to discover leaks that develop hours or days later as water finds new pathways. Debris impact from storms can create immediate openings or weaken structural elements that fail later.

Common Emergency Response Process

Emergency roofing response typically follows this process:

  1. Initial assessment - A qualified professional will evaluate the situation remotely or in-person to determine urgency

  2. Safety measures - Immediate steps to prevent further damage, which may include emergency tarping, water extraction, or temporary structural support

  3. Damage documentation - Thorough inspection to identify all compromised areas for insurance purposes

  4. Temporary stabilization - Measures to secure the property until permanent repairs can be scheduled

  5. Repair planning - Development of a comprehensive repair strategy addressing both immediate and underlying issues

Emergency Prevention Tips

  • Schedule annual roof inspections, especially before rainy season in fall
  • Keep gutters and downspouts clear to prevent water backup under roofing materials
  • Trim overhanging tree branches that could fall during storms
  • Address minor leaks immediately before they become major problems
  • Monitor attic spaces after heavy weather for signs of moisture or daylight penetration
  • Ensure proper attic ventilation to prevent ice dams and heat-related deterioration
  • Document your roof's condition with photos for insurance purposes

Emergency Service FAQs

Common questions about emergency residential & commercial roofing in Antioch

What qualifies as a roofing emergency vs. routine repair?

Emergency situations involve active water intrusion, structural compromise, or immediate safety hazards. Routine repairs include minor leaks during dry weather, cosmetic damage, or planned maintenance. If water is actively entering your home or business, treat it as an emergency.

How quickly can emergency roofing services respond in Antioch?

Many local roofing professionals offer same-day emergency response, particularly for active leaks or structural issues. Response times may vary based on weather conditions and service demand, but emergency tarping services are often available within hours.

Will emergency repairs be covered by insurance?

Most homeowner's and commercial property insurance policies cover sudden, accidental damage from storms, falling objects, or other covered perils. Document all damage with photos before making temporary repairs, and keep receipts for emergency services. Your insurance company may require specific documentation procedures.

What temporary measures can I take while waiting for professionals?

Safety first: If electrical hazards exist, avoid the area. For active leaks, place buckets to catch water and move valuables away. Do not attempt roof access without proper safety equipment. Emergency tarping should only be performed by professionals with proper fall protection.

How do I choose between temporary repair and full replacement?

Emergency specialists will assess whether temporary measures are sufficient or if immediate replacement is necessary. Factors include extent of damage, roof age, material condition, and safety considerations. Temporary repairs are designed to protect your property until permanent solutions can be properly planned and executed.

What should I look for in an emergency roofing provider?

Verify proper licensing, insurance coverage, and local experience. Emergency roofing requires specific expertise in temporary stabilization and damage assessment. Look for providers familiar with Antioch's building codes and common roofing materials in the area.
